Infantile atopic eczema is defined as atopic eczema present during the first year of life. It typically first manifests between the ages of 2 and 6 months: approximately 50% of people with atopic eczema first present in infancy. The face and non-flexural areas are commonly affected. The napkin area tends to be relatively spared. Involvement of the limb flexures, as is typical in childhood atopic eczema, is also often seen in infancy.
